Hi,

 

I am currently claiming JSA and have been for only 4 weeks (not even had my 1st pay yet) and I have been offered a job that is to start in June. Now the problem is, the job would mean me relocating down to London and I live up north. I used all my savings that I had (wasn't much) before claiming JSA as I really didn't want to claim this, but with the current job situation in the UK it, it was more difficult that I had anticipated!

Now my problem is this, I don't have the money to relocate, i.e pay for deposits and letting agent fees. I spoke to my local job centre, who basically laughed and said they are not a charity at the end of the day, and because I have not been claiming for 26 weeks, I am not entitled to any help anyway, which seems a little wrong to be penalized for finding a job quickly instead of dragging it out for 26 weeks (not saying that is what people are doing, but i'm sure you all know what I mean!) Is anybody able to shed any light on this for me, if I am not able to get any help, then I am going to have to give up the job, the employer dose not offer relocation packages because of the sheer number of people that work for them.

 

Any advice would be gratefully appreciated.
